Subject: 27.1; tab-bar missed mouse clicks on MS-Windows
Date: Sat, 3 Apr 2021 12:20:36 +0100
There appears to be an issue with the tab bar on MS-Windows that
sometimes it does not register mouse clicks.

Steps to reproduce

1. Run emacs -Q.
2. M-x tab-bar-mode, the tab bar opens with a tab on the *scratch*
   buffer.
3. Press the + button on the tab bar, a second tab is created on the
   same buffer.
4. Keep switching between the two tabs using the mouse, you will
   notice that sometimes clicking on the inactive tab does not
   activate it as expected.

Analysis and likely solution to follow.
